40 CFR § 180.546 - Mefenoxam; tolerances for residues.

§ 180.546 Mefenoxam; tolerances for residues.

(a) General. Tolerances are established for residues of mefenoxam, including its metabolites and degradates, in or on the commodities in the table below. Compliance with the tolerance levels specified below is to be determined by measuring only metalaxyl (methyl N-(2,6-dimethylphenyl)-N-(methoxyacetyl)-DL-alaninate).

Table 1 to Paragraph (a)

Commodity Parts per million
Almond hulls 5
Artichoke, globe 0.05
Atemoya 0.20
Bean, snap, succulent 0.20
Bushberry subgroup 13-07B 2.0
Cacao, dried bean 0.20
Caneberry subgroup 13-07A 0.70
Canistel 0.40
Cottonseed, subgroup 20C 0.1
Custard apple 0.20
Fruit, small, vine climbing, except grape, subgroup 13-07E 0.10
Herbs, dried 55
Herbs, fresh 8.0
Leaf petiole, subgroup 22B 5
Leafy Vegetable, Crop Group 4-16 (except spinach) 5
Mango 0.40
Onion, bulb, subgroup 3-07A 3.0
Onion, green, subgroup 3-07B 10
Papaya 0.40
Rapeseed subgroup 20A 0.05
Sapodilla 0.40
Sapote, black 0.40
Sapote, mamey 0.40
Spinach 10
Star apple 0.40
Starfruit 0.20
Sugar apple 0.20
Tree nut, crop group 14-12 0.3
Vegetable, Brassica, head and stem, group 5-16 2
Vegetable, fruiting, group 8-10 1
Vegetable, legume, bean, succulent shelled, subgroup 6-22C 0.2
Vegetable, legume, pea, succulent shelled, subgroup 6-22D 0.2
Vegetable, stalk and stem, subgroup 22A 7
Wasabi, stem 3.0
Wasabi, tops 6.0

(d) Indirect or inadvertent residues. Tolerances are established for indirect or inadvertent residues of mefenoxam in or on the food commodities when present therein as a result of the application of mefenoxam to growing crops listed in paragraph (a) of this section and other non-food crops to read as follows:

Table 2 to Paragraph (d)

Commodity Parts per
million
Sugarcane 0.1
